As someone who is every day in multiple video conferences I'm always surprised that hardly any tool is able to create user friendly invitations. Most of the time I get a wall of text in the meeting description, often with multiple links, and than I have to search for the right link to join the meeting.

The link to the meeting belongs to the "location" field! The description is for additional information such as the meeting agenda.

This is one of many reasons why I appreciate invitations via Nextcloud Talk so much. It is one of the few tools that does this correctly.
